In this episode of\u00a0<b>CNN Original Series <\/b><b><i>K-Everything<\/i><\/b>, host and executive producer, <b>Daniel Dae Kim<\/b> explores the meteoric rise of Korean food, in a story that is not just about what to eat and how to make it, but about nostalgia, pride, innovation, and determination.\u00a0\u00a0<\/p>\n<div class=\"PRN_ImbeddedAssetReference\">\n<p> <a href=\"https:\/\/mma.prnasia.com\/media2\/2982834\/image1.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\"> <img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/mma.prnasia.com\/media2\/2982834\/image1.jpg?p=medium600\" title=\"Daniel Dae Kim savors South Korea\u2019s food scene in CNN Original Series K-Everything\" alt=\"Daniel Dae Kim savors South Korea\u2019s food scene in CNN Original Series K-Everything\"\/> <\/a> <br \/><span>Daniel Dae Kim savors South Korea\u2019s food scene in CNN Original Series K-Everything<\/span><\/p>\n<\/div>\n<p>Starting in Pyeongchang, Kim and his parents visit one of South Korea&#8217;s biggest\u00a0kimjang which takes place every November \u2013 a festival where people come together to ferment vast quantities of kimchi in preparation for winter. Returning to Seoul, Daniel meets food stylist <b>Ellie Lee<\/b> who recreates a dish she prepared for <i>Squid Game<\/i>, explaining the outsized role the media has played in the global proliferation of Korea&#8217;s culinary culture.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Kim then explores\u00a0Gyeongdong\u00a0Market, a <span>hub<\/span> for Korean street food where every bite takes him back to his childhood. He accompanies chef <b>Corey Lee<\/b>, the first Korean chef to receive three Michelin stars for his San Francisco restaurant Benu, to one of his favorite restaurants in Seoul: a small mom-and-pop that only serves raw, soy-marinated crab.<\/p>\n<p>In Korea, meeting up for a drink isn&#8217;t a straightforward affair, where it is coded with strict rules of etiquette and plays an important role in socializing. Three legendary chefs and restauranteurs, Corey Lee,\u00a0<b>Mingoo<\/b>\u00a0<b>Kang<\/b> and <b>Lucia Cho<\/b>, provide Kim with a refresher course on the protocol of alcohol, but not before Kim goes on a trip to GS25, Korea&#8217;s answer to 7-Eleven and home to almost every snack imaginable.<\/p>\n<p>Kim reconnects with Corey Lee for a meal at a restaurant specializing in\u00a0kimchi jjigae, or kimchi stew, a popular and resourceful dish that has endured through the country&#8217;s occupation, widespread poverty and two wars.<\/p>\n<p>At a mountainside retreat in Pyeongchang, Kim learns from Chef <b>Cho<\/b>\u00a0<b>Hee-sook<\/b>, known as the &#8216;Godmother of Korean cuisine&#8217;, who teaches him about the fundamental &#8216;mother sauces&#8217; that give Korean cuisine its bold, distinct flavors.
